New SRAM Red AXS Update Improves Shifting Speed

SRAM announced a firmware update for its Red AXS groupset that promises faster shifting response times and improved battery optimization.

The update, available through the SRAM AXS app, reduces the shift delay by approximately 15 milliseconds. While this may seem minor, competitive cyclists report noticeable improvements during sprint finishes and rapid gear changes on variable terrain.

Key Improvements

Battery life sees a modest 8% improvement thanks to more efficient motor control. The update also adds a new sprint mode that prioritizes shift speed over battery conservation for race situations.

Riders can download the update now through both iOS and Android versions of the SRAM AXS app. The process takes about 5 minutes per derailleur.

This marks SRAM third major firmware update of the year, showing their commitment to continuous improvement of existing hardware through software enhancements.
